# Break-Glass: Catalog Cache Invalidation

Scope: the Pinrow product catalog at Veldstone Retail. If stale prices persist after a purge and the Hollowmere invalidation queue is wedged, use break-glass to flush the edge tier directly. Contractors: get verbal sign-off from the catalog lead first. Steps: open the Hollowmere admin shell, select emergency-flush, confirm the tenant, and run it once — repeated flushes thrash the origin. Access is logged and expires after 20 minutes. Unseal the admin shell with the passphrase below.

recovery phrase for kahop-tajog: istix-casvan

Finance Review Summary — Inventory Write-Down

Branch managers: quick heads-up that Hartlowe Supply is booking a write-down on aged Fenbrook-line stock this quarter, roughly 6% of holdings. Mostly slow movers from the Dunmere warehouse. Expect tighter reorder thresholds from next month. The confidential planning note behind this decision appears below.

internal memo for taguf-kafop: Novmirax Group plans to lower the Oliius list price by 42.0 percent in March. The board signed off on a budget of $367.8 million for Project Belael. The renewal with Drumirax Logistics closes at $302.4 million a year, 54.0 percent below the last contract. Project Kelys slips by a full year because of the staffing delay.

## Onboarding: Fareweight Rules Engine

Fareweight computes shipping fees from stacked rule sets. Rules are versioned; never edit a live version. Deploys go through the staging evaluator first. Read the rule DSL guide before touching anything.

Rule definitions live in the pricing database — connect to it with the connection string below.

primary connection of yagep-bajop = postgresql://druiel_svc:gW@db-3860.sivrelworks.example:5432/brieth